What Is the Cost to Launch an Augmented Reality Development Business?
# Startup Cost Description Min Amount Max Amount
1 Office Lease & Setup Rent, furnishings, utilities, and internet installation for workspace. $6,000 $17,500
2 Computer & AR Hardware High-performance PCs, AR headsets, testing devices, and storage. $12,500 $25,500
3 Software Licenses Development tools, 3D modeling software, SDKs, and collaboration platforms. $4,400 $10,700
4 Legal & Registration Business registration, trademark filings, and contract drafting fees. $2,800 $6,700
5 Marketing & Branding Logo design, website development, demo videos, and ad campaigns. $6,000 $15,000
6 Staff Recruitment Hiring expenses, onboarding, and signing bonuses for key employees. $5,000 $14,000
7 Prototype & Demo AR app prototypes, asset creation, and user testing sessions. $8,000 $20,000
Total $44,700 $109,400

Main Factors Influencing AR Startup Costs


  • Office Location & Workspace Size: Urban tech hubs command higher rent, but remote teams can cut overhead by up to 40%.
  • Scope of AR Solutions: Custom, enterprise-grade apps demand more resources than off-the-shelf or template-based projects.
  • Talent Acquisition: Skilled AR developers, 3D artists, and UX/UI designers average $110,000/year in the U.S., heavily impacting payroll.
  • Hardware & Software Licensing: High-performance computers and AR devices add $20,000+ upfront; enterprise licenses for Unity or Unreal can exceed $5,000/year.
  • Intellectual Property & Legal: Trademarking, patents, and legal fees for contracts are necessary but often overlooked costs.
  • Marketing & Client Acquisition: Website creation, demo production, and paid advertising are vital early expenses to attract clients.

Major One-Time AR Business Startup Expenses


  • Office Lease Deposit & Build-Out: Security deposits and workspace customization typically range from $3,000 to $10,000, depending on location and size.
  • Computer & Hardware Purchases: High-performance PCs, AR headsets like HoloLens 2 (~$3,500/unit), and testing devices can cost between $15,000 and $30,000 upfront.
  • Software Licenses & Tools: One-time setup fees for Unity Pro, Unreal Engine, 3D modeling suites, and AR SDKs usually fall between $2,000 and $8,000.
  • Legal & IP Setup: Business registration, contracts, and IP filings average $2,500 to $7,000, essential for protecting your AR software development pricing and innovations.
  • Initial Marketing Materials: Website design, branding, demo videos, and portfolio creation can cost from $5,000 to $12,000, crucial for attracting early clients.
  • Recruiting & Onboarding: Fees for job postings, recruiters, and onboarding range between $3,000 and $8,000, depending on your team size.
  • Prototype & Demo Development: Building interactive AR demos for pitches typically requires a budget of $5,000 to $15,000.

Key Monthly Expenses to Budget For


  • Office Rent & Utilities: Expect to pay between $2,000 and $7,000 per month for tech hub office space, including electricity, internet, and insurance.
  • Payroll & Benefits: Salaries for a 5-person AR team typically run from $40,000 to $60,000 monthly, reflecting the high demand for skilled developers and designers.
  • Software Subscriptions: Ongoing licenses for Unity, Unreal Engine, cloud storage, and collaboration tools usually cost $500 to $2,500 per month.
  • Marketing & Lead Generation: Allocate $1,000 to $5,000 monthly for paid ads, SEO, event sponsorships, and networking to attract clients and grow your pipeline.
  • Device & Hardware Maintenance: Budget $200 to $1,000 per month for repairs, upgrades, and replacements of AR headsets and testing devices.
  • Cloud Hosting & Data Storage: Hosting AR content and client assets typically costs $300 to $1,500 monthly, depending on project scale.
  • Professional Services: Accounting, legal, and consulting fees average between $500 and $2,000 per month, essential for compliance and smooth operations.

Key Pitfalls to Avoid in AR Startup Cost Estimation


  • Underestimating talent costs: Skilled AR developers and 3D artists command salaries averaging $110,000/year in the U.S., often more with experience.
  • Overlooking device testing needs: Comprehensive QA requires multiple AR devices like HoloLens 2 ($3,500+) and Magic Leap 2 ($3,299), adding significant expenses.
  • Ignoring software update fees: Recurring costs for SDK updates, Unity Pro, or Unreal Engine licenses can exceed $5,000/year per seat.
  • Underfunding marketing efforts: Insufficient budget for demos, case studies, and lead generation can stall client acquisition and growth.

KPI 2: Computer & AR Hardware


Investing in the right computer and AR hardware is a cornerstone of launching a successful augmented reality development business. This expense directly impacts your team's ability to build, test, and deliver immersive AR applications efficiently. Given the rapid evolution of AR technology, budgeting accurately for high-performance devices and testing equipment is essential to avoid costly delays or compromises in quality.


Primary Cost Drivers

The main costs include high-performance development PCs or laptops priced between $2,000 and $4,000 per unit, alongside AR headsets such as the HoloLens 2 at $3,500 or Magic Leap 2 at $3,299. You’ll also need tablets and smartphones for testing, with an initial hardware batch typically costing between $10,000 and $20,000. Additional expenses include device charging stations and secure storage, which can add another $500 to $1,500 to your startup budget.

Factors Affecting Cost

  • The number of developers and testers requiring dedicated hardware
  • Choice between premium AR headsets and more budget-friendly testing devices
  • Necessity for multiple device types to cover diverse AR platforms
  • Investment in secure storage and charging infrastructure to protect expensive equipment

Potential Cost Savings

You can reduce your AR development budget by prioritizing essential hardware first and scaling as your business grows. Leasing or buying refurbished high-performance PCs and AR devices can also trim upfront costs without sacrificing performance.

  • Lease high-performance development PCs instead of buying
  • Purchase refurbished AR headsets and testing devices
  • Start with a minimal viable hardware set for prototyping
  • Use shared devices among team members when feasible
  • Negotiate bulk purchase discounts with hardware suppliers
  • Utilize cloud-based development environments to reduce local hardware needs
  • Implement strict device management to extend hardware lifespan
  • Consider cross-platform testing tools to minimize physical device requirements


KPI 3: Software Licenses & Development Tools


Software licenses and development tools form the backbone of any augmented reality development business. For AR Visionaries, investing in the right platforms and software ensures the creation of high-quality, immersive applications that clients demand. These costs are often a significant portion of your AR business startup expenses, with variations depending on the scale and complexity of your projects.


Core Software Expenses

The primary costs include enterprise licenses for game engines like Unity Pro or Unreal Engine, which range from $1,800 to $4,000 per year per seat. Additionally, 3D modeling software such as Adobe Creative Cloud ($600/year) and Autodesk Maya ($1,700/year) are essential for asset creation. Initial setup of AR SDKs, collaboration tools, and version control platforms typically adds another $2,000 to $5,000 to your budget.

Factors Affecting Cost

  • Number of developer seats/licenses required
  • Choice between Unity Pro and Unreal Engine enterprise versions
  • Selection of 3D modeling and design software
  • Complexity and scale of AR SDKs and collaboration tools integration

Potential Cost Savings

You can reduce software license expenses by carefully selecting tools that match your team’s skill set and project needs. Opting for subscription models with scalable seats and leveraging open-source or bundled SDKs can also lower upfront costs.

  • Negotiate multi-seat license discounts
  • Use free or lower-tier versions during early development
  • Leverage bundled software suites like Adobe Creative Cloud
  • Adopt open-source or community-supported AR SDKs
  • Share licenses across remote teams when possible
  • Regularly audit software usage to avoid unnecessary renewals
  • Invest in training to maximize tool efficiency
  • Utilize cloud-based collaboration tools to reduce infrastructure costs


KPI 4: Legal, IP, and Business Registration


Securing the legal foundation is a critical step in launching your augmented reality development business. This expense ensures your company, AR Visionaries, operates within the law, protects its intellectual property, and establishes trustworthy client relationships. Given the complexity of AR technology and the competitive landscape, budgeting accurately for legal, IP, and registration costs is essential to avoid costly delays or disputes.


Core Legal and Registration Expenses

The primary costs include business entity registration fees, which vary by state from $300 to $1,200. Trademark application and legal consultation fees range between $1,500 and $3,000, essential for protecting your AR brand and technology. Additionally, drafting standard client contracts typically costs $1,000 to $2,500, setting clear terms for your AR development projects.

Factors Affecting Cost

  • State-specific business registration fees and requirements
  • Complexity and number of trademarks filed for AR software and branding
  • Scope and customization level of client contracts
  • Legal consultation depth for IP protection and compliance

Potential Cost Savings

You can reduce your legal and registration expenses by using standardized documents and focusing trademark filings on key assets. Early consultation with specialized AR IP attorneys can prevent costly issues later. Leveraging online business registration services also trims fees without sacrificing compliance.

  • Use online platforms for business registration
  • File trademarks selectively, prioritizing core AR assets
  • Adopt templated client contracts with minimal customization
  • Bundle legal services to negotiate package pricing
  • Engage freelance legal consultants for specific tasks
  • Utilize pro bono or startup legal clinics if eligible
  • Review and update contracts periodically to avoid frequent rewrites
  • Leverage industry associations for legal guidance and discounts
